An easy 4.3-mile circular of two hours with 140 metres of climbing, from the Spa along the South Bay sands to the harbour and lighthouse, up onto the castle headland and back down through St Nicholas Gardens past the Central Tramway. Start at the Spa, where there is pay-and-display parking on Foreshore Road, or walk down from Scarborough station in about fifteen minutes. Hard surfaces and steps rather than mud, so kind on old paws, but the South Bay beach is closed to dogs in summer and the harbourside is busy with traffic, fish waste and bold gulls.

THE SMALL PRINTScarborough South Bay beach is closed to dogs from the West Pier to the southernmost flight of steps by the underground car park roundabout between 1 May and 30 September under North Yorkshire Council's dog control order. Outside those months the sands are open; in summer walk the beach south of the Spa towards Holbeck, or take the castle headland and Marine Drive, which allow dogs all year.
